Barry Melrose fired

Associate coach Rick Tocchet will take over as interim coach. This comes after only 16 games into the season, where the Lightning are 5-7-4. Is it really Melrose's fault? Perhaps. But Lightning management threw a whole bunch of new faces onto the team and expected too much as well. You can't always buy chemistry.
Somewhere John Tortorella is laughing.

Here is a clip of an interview with Melrose after his firing. He says it's harder to get guys to compete for 60 minutes than it was back in the early 90's.
